Lightyear logo

Growth · Software Engineer Interview Guide

Sign up to see ATS

How to Pass the Lightyear Software Engineer Interview in 2026

The Lightyear DNA (TL;DR)

Lightyear's emphasis on empowering retail investors drives its hiring, seeking individuals who can simplify complex financial concepts. The interview process frequently probes how candidates would contribute to features like 'Global Market Intelligence' or 'Money Market Funds', demonstrating clarity in thought and practical application.

The Lightyear Interview Loop

Your onsite loop will typically consist of 5 rounds.

  1. 1

    Round 1

    Recruiter Screen
    Motivation, role fit, logistics.
  2. 2

    Round 2

    Coding Screen
    LeetCode-medium algorithmic problems under time pressure.
  3. 3

    Round 3

    System Design
    Distributed systems, trade-offs at scale, architecture under constraints.
  4. 4

    Round 4

    Onsite Coding
    LeetCode-hard, debugging, code clarity, edge cases.
  5. 5

    Round 5

    Behavioral / Leadership
    Past evidence of ownership, influence, resolving conflict.

The Danger Zone: Top Reasons Candidates Fail

Based on our database of Lightyear interview outcomes, avoid these common traps:

  • Using aggressive or manipulative tactics instead of logical persuasion.
  • Describing a situation where they were simply assigned a task.
  • Not explaining their own reasoning or data clearly.
  • Not considering memory usage for potentially large historical datasets.

Test Yourself: Real Lightyear Questions

Three real prompts pulled from our database.

Type · Ownership

Tell me about a time you took initiative to improve a sales process or overcome a significant obstacle that wasn't explicitly part of your job description.

Type · Conflict Resolution

Tell me about a time you had a significant disagreement with a stakeholder (e.g., engineer, designer, marketing lead) about a product decision. How did you approach it, and what was the outcome?

Type · Data Consistency

How would you ensure data consistency across different services (e.g., trading service, portfolio service, analytics service) in a distributed fintech environment like Lightyear?

+ many more questions, signals, and worked examples

Sign up to unlock the JobMentis grading rubric

Unlock the rubric

Lightyear Interview Question Bank

A sample from our database, grouped by round. Sign up to see the full set.

9 of 21 questions shown

1

Recruiter Screen

1
  1. 1

    Type · Motivation

    Why are you interested in working at Lightyear specifically, and what excites you about the fintech space?
2

Coding Screen

3
  1. 2

    Type · Algorithmic

    Given a list of stock trades with timestamps and prices, write a function to calculate the maximum profit that could have been made by buying and selling a single stock once. Assume you must buy before you sell.
  2. 3

    Type · Algorithmic

    Implement a function that takes a string representing a user's portfolio value (e.g., '$1,234.56') and converts it into a numerical representation (e.g., 1234.56). Handle potential errors like invalid characters or formatting.
  3. + 1 more questions in this round (sign up to unlock)
3

System Design

3
  1. 4

    Type · API Design

    Design the API for a service that allows users to view their real-time portfolio value. Consider how to handle updates, potential latency, and different user devices.
  2. 5

    Type · Scalability

    Lightyear is experiencing rapid user growth. How would you scale the system responsible for processing and displaying stock price updates to millions of concurrent users?
  3. + 1 more questions in this round (sign up to unlock)
4

Onsite Coding

3
  1. 6

    Type · Algorithmic

    Write a function to determine if a given sequence of stock trades represents a valid sequence of buy and sell orders for a single user, considering that a user cannot sell a stock they don't own, and must buy before they can sell.
  2. 7

    Type · Debugging

    A user reports that their portfolio value is showing incorrectly after executing a trade. Here's the relevant code snippet for updating portfolio value. Debug and identify the potential issue.
  3. + 1 more questions in this round (sign up to unlock)
5

Behavioral / Leadership

11
  1. 8

    Type · Conflict Resolution

    Tell me about a time you had a significant disagreement with a stakeholder (e.g., engineer, designer, marketing lead) about a product decision. How did you approach it, and what was the outcome?
  2. 9

    Type · Ownership

    Tell me about a time you took ownership of a problem that wasn't strictly your responsibility. What was the situation, and what was the outcome?
  3. + 9 more questions in this round (sign up to unlock)

Unlock the full Lightyear question bank

Free signup, no credit card. You get every question + the framework, grading signals, and worked answer for each.

Unlock all questions

Interview tracks at Lightyear

How Lightyear's DNA translates across functions. Pick your role.

Compare Lightyear with similar employers

Same DNA, different bar. Browse the closest companies in our database and see how their loops differ.

Practice Lightyear interviews end-to-end

FAQ

WorkfiveExplore careers on Workfive